Nonfuel Mineral Resources
Minerals found in the Earth's crust that are used for everything except fuel, such as metals, stone, and industrial minerals like gypsum and salt.
Metamorphic Rock
Rock that has been transformed by heat, pressure, or chemical processes from its original state into a new form.
Anthracite
A hard, compact variety of coal that has a high luster and carbon content.
Slate
Slate is a fine-grained metamorphic rock that can be split into thin layers, often used for roofing, flooring, and historical writing tablets.
